112 changes: 110 additions & 2 deletions src/core/agents/stream-utils.ts
Original file line number Diff line number Diff line change
Expand Up @@ -2,8 +2,105 @@ import type { ChildProcess } from "node:child_process";
import type { Readable } from "node:stream";
import type { WriteStream } from "node:fs";

/** Upper bound on the stdout tail kept for non-zero-exit error reporting. */
const MAX_EXIT_OUTPUT_CHARS = 4_000;
/**
* Wire stderr collection, spawn-error handling, and the common close-handler
* Tighter bound on unstructured stdout quoted back in the failure detail: that
* text lands in notes.md and is replayed in every later iteration prompt.
*/
const MAX_RAW_TAIL_CHARS = 400;
const RAW_TAIL_ELISION = "[...truncated, full output in the iteration log] ";

/** Keep only the end of a stream so long-running processes stay bounded. */
export function appendExitOutputTail(existing: string, chunk: string): string {
const combined = existing + chunk;
return combined.length > MAX_EXIT_OUTPUT_CHARS
? combined.slice(combined.length - MAX_EXIT_OUTPUT_CHARS)
: combined;
}

function errorTextFromEvent(event: unknown): string | null {
if (!event || typeof event !== "object") return null;
const record = event as Record<string, unknown>;

const error = record.error;
if (typeof error === "string" && error.trim()) return error.trim();
if (error && typeof error === "object") {
const message = (error as Record<string, unknown>).message;
if (typeof message === "string" && message.trim()) return message.trim();
}

if (record.is_error === true || record.type === "error") {
for (const key of ["result", "message", "subtype"]) {
const value = record[key];
if (typeof value === "string" && value.trim()) return value.trim();
}
}

return null;
}

function elideRawTail(raw: string): string {
return raw.length > MAX_RAW_TAIL_CHARS
? `${RAW_TAIL_ELISION}${raw.slice(raw.length - MAX_RAW_TAIL_CHARS)}`
: raw;
}

interface StdoutFailure {
structured: string;
reported: string;
}

function extractStdoutError(stdoutTail: string): StdoutFailure {
const messages: string[] = [];
for (const line of stdoutTail.split("\n")) {
if (!line.trim()) continue;
try {
const message = errorTextFromEvent(JSON.parse(line));
if (message) messages.push(message);
} catch {
// Not JSON: covered by the raw-tail fallback below.
}
}
const structured = messages.join("\n");
return {
structured,
reported: structured || elideRawTail(stdoutTail.trim()),
};
}

export interface ChildProcessExitFailure {
detail: string;
/** CLI-authored error text suitable for permanent-error classification. */
errorOutput: string;
}

/**
* Describe a non-zero exit. The detail reports both streams, while
* `errorOutput` excludes unstructured stdout that may merely quote an error.
*/
export function describeChildProcessExit(
agentName: string,
code: number | null,
stdoutTail: string,
stderr: string,
): ChildProcessExitFailure {
const trimmedStderr = stderr.trim();
const stdoutError = extractStdoutError(stdoutTail);
const segments = [trimmedStderr, stdoutError.reported].filter(Boolean);
return {
detail:
segments.length > 0
? `${agentName} exited with code ${code}: ${segments.join("\n")}`
: `${agentName} exited with code ${code} and produced no output`,
errorOutput: [trimmedStderr, stdoutError.structured]
.filter(Boolean)
.join("\n"),
};
}

/**
* Wire output collection, spawn-error handling, and the common close-handler
* prefix (logStream.end + non-zero exit code rejection) for a child process.
* Calls `onSuccess` only when the process exits with code 0.
*/
